Gothic Braid Magic

The Wednesday Addams aesthetic never dies. Channel Jenna Ortega’s iconic Netflix look with goth, braided hairstyles, and a sleek center part. Smooth flyaways with styling cream, braid tightly, and pair it with a dark academia outfit to master that eerie charm of the Addams Family.
Color-Pop Chaos

Go bold with Harley Quinn’s signature style. The Margot Robbie-inspired high pigtails, pink and blue streaks, and two-tone hair create an instantly playful, rebellious, and colorful vibe. Add clip-in extensions for drama and you’re ready to rock a fun Halloween favorite.
Galactic Buns

No one forgets Princess Leia’s iconic side buns. This classic Star Wars hairstyle is a pop-culture legend. Twist your hair into cinnamon buns near your ears, add a white outfit, and you’ll look instantly recognizable across the galaxy.
Retro Glam Curls

Recreate the magic of Sandy from Grease with blonde curls, red lipstick, and a leather jacket. Use volumizing products for bouncy curls and that perfect retro glam feel. Inspired by Kelsea Ballerini’s modern version, this look screams movie-star transformation and timeless cool.
Playful Pigtails

Pay homage to Baby Spice and the Spice Girls era with pigtails, light makeup, and a mist of texturizing spray. This 90s-inspired look brings back pure nostalgia and pop-culture fun. Throw on something pastel and let your inner Emma Bunton shine.
High Pony Glam

Bring out your inner Ariana Grande with her signature high ponytail. Sleek, glossy, and effortlessly chic, this celebrity-style staple works with a pink mini dress, oversized hoodie, or tall boots. It’s the ultimate confident Halloween hairstyle that never goes out of trend.
Spooky Braid Queen

For a hauntingly stylish vibe, try the Spider Queen look. Create a braided ponytail and weave in plastic spiders and a zipper for spooky texture. The result? A DIY costume that’s both creative and edgy, blending chilling aesthetics with dramatic flair.
Hollywood Blonde

Channel Marilyn Monroe with platinum-blonde curls, a sultry red lipstick, and her iconic beauty mark. Whether your hair is short or long, pin it into a short bob for that vintage glamour. It’s the easiest way to capture true Hollywood icon energy.
Riveting Red Bandana

Step into the shoes of Rosie the Riveter, the American icon of empowerment. Tie a red bandana or scarf in a classic knot over a messy bun and leave a few loose strands for charm. It’s vintage, strong, and perfect for those who love simple yet bold hairstyles.
Anime Dream

Transform into Sailor Moon with her legendary high ponytails and side bangs. Wrap a thick strand of hair around each base, DIY a tiara, and embrace your magical girl moment. This fantasy-inspired look—spotted on Paris Hilton—is sleek, blonde, and unmistakably cosplay-ready.
Golden Gaze

Go mythic with Medusa’s serpentine style. Create a braided updo with snakes, gold accents, and a hint of bronze eyeshadow for drama. Inspired by Greek mythology, this statement hairstyle channels your inner Halloween queen while looking fierce and unforgettable.
Glam Mermaid Braid

Make waves with the Modern Mermaid braid. Start with a high ponytail, use styling paste, and weave a long braid. Add seashells, ribbon, or starfish details for undersea glamour. It’s an Ariel-inspired look that merges fantasy with red-carpet-worthy shine.
Rockstar Volume

Turn up the volume with an ’80s Rockstar hairstyle. Think big curls, bold texture, and loads of shine. Use a diffuser, curling wand, and some backcombing to perfect that glam-rock, rebellious vibe. Take a cue from Imaan Hammam—party hair has never looked this bold.
